## Deployment

The Quillbrook handlers run on a serverless runtime and are subject to cold starts of up to four seconds when traffic drops below one request per minute. We mitigate this with a warming ping every 45 seconds from the scheduler, which touches only the health route and carries no credentials. Cold starts re-read all environment configuration at init, so stale values persist only until the next instance cycle. The current values are listed below.

deployment values, hagug-fahog:
ZOROX_LOG_LEVEL=debug
ZOROX_METRICS_HOST=metrics.zorox.paliqlabs.internal
ZOROX_POOL_SIZE=16

- [ ] **Step 7: Breaker override escrow.** After sealing the signing keys for the Tallgrove upstream API circuit breaker, confirm the support team can force the breaker open during a full outage. The override bundle lives in the sealed escrow drawer and is useless without its unlock phrase. Two ceremony witnesses must initial this step before proceeding. The escrow bundle is decrypted with the recovery passphrase that follows.

vault phrase of kahip-kahop = holath-quenmir

## Idempotency Keys for Payment Retries (Lumopay)

Every retry of a charge request must reuse the original idempotency key; generating a new key on retry can produce duplicate charges. Keys are scoped per merchant and expire after 48 hours. Reviewers should verify keys are derived server-side, never from client input. The full key-generation specification and threat model are maintained on the internal page.

dashboard of kaguf-tawip = https://vault.merlaqsys.test/issue

Support staff fielding out-of-memory reports should confirm customers renamed the key; the old name is silently ignored as of this release. Note that the export worker also now authenticates to the render farm separately, so customer .env files need an additional credential. When walking a customer through the upgrade, have them append the following line.

secret setting of hawep-yahig: LEDGER_TOKEN29=41b5d6315371c92885eaeb077fb63